本發明是有關於一種包藥方法與系統,特別是指一種能減少藥劑師調劑藥品時的工作負擔的包藥方法與系統。The invention relates to a medicine method and system, in particular to a medicine method and system capable of reducing the workload of a pharmacist when dispensing medicines.
一般來說,醫師在看診完畢之後會在電腦中輸入欲開立的藥方,然後列印出藥單提供給藥劑師,藥劑師再根據藥單來包藥。在包藥過程中,藥劑師需按照藥單中的每一藥品的名稱及藥量,找到藥品所放置的位置並拿取該藥量的藥品。Generally speaking, after the doctor finishes the examination, the doctor will input the prescription to be opened in the computer, and then print out the medicine list to provide the pharmacist, and the pharmacist will then apply the medicine according to the medicine list. During the drug-packing process, the pharmacist needs to find the location where the drug is placed and take the drug according to the name and amount of each drug in the drug list.
然而,通常來說,藥品的種類繁多,若藥劑師無法熟記每一藥品所放置的位置,則包藥過程將會耗費藥劑師不少時間及精神來尋找藥品所放置的位置。此外,在包藥過程中,藥劑師還要兼顧所拿取藥量的正確性,更加重藥劑師在精神上的負擔;而若精神上的負擔過重,也較容易造成調劑錯誤。However, in general, there are many types of medicines. If the pharmacist cannot memorize the location of each medicine, the medicine process will take the pharmacist a lot of time and effort to find the location where the medicine is placed. In addition, in the process of medicine, the pharmacist should also take into account the correctness of the amount of medicine taken, and further burden the pharmacist mentally; and if the mental burden is too heavy, it is more likely to cause adjustment errors.
因此,本發明之目的,即在提供一種能讓藥劑師不需熟記藥品所放置位置並方便地確認藥品名稱及其對應藥量的正確性的包藥方法。Accordingly, it is an object of the present invention to provide a method of dispensing a drug that allows a pharmacist to remember the location of the drug and conveniently confirm the correctness of the drug name and its corresponding drug amount.
於是,本發明包藥方法由一電腦、一行動裝置與一包藥系統實施。該包藥系統包含多個藥品模組及一控制模組,每一藥品模組對應一藥品名稱且包括一藥罐、一名稱燈號,及一數量燈號。該控制模組可與該電腦與該行動裝置無線通訊。該包藥方法包含一步驟(a)、一步驟(b)、一步驟(c),及一步驟(d)。Thus, the method of packaging of the present invention is carried out by a computer, a mobile device and a drug dispensing system. The drug dispensing system comprises a plurality of drug modules and a control module, each drug module corresponding to a drug name and comprising a medicine can, a name light, and a quantity of lights. The control module can wirelessly communicate with the mobile device with the computer. The method of packaging includes a step (a), a step (b), a step (c), and a step (d).
該步驟(a)是該電腦發送一藥方資訊給該行動裝置與該控制模組,其中該藥方資訊包含多個藥品名稱與該等藥品名稱各別對應的藥量。In the step (a), the computer sends a prescription information to the mobile device and the control module, wherein the prescription information includes a plurality of drug names corresponding to the drug names respectively.
該步驟(b)是當該控制模組接收到該藥方資訊時,該控制模組控制該藥方資訊中的每一藥品名稱所對應的藥品模組的名稱燈號與數量燈號顯示一第一顏色的號誌。The step (b) is: when the control module receives the prescription information, the control module controls the name of the medicine module corresponding to each medicine name in the prescription information, and the number of the light number displays a first The number of the color.
該步驟(c)是該行動裝置針對每一藥品名稱,傳送一對應該藥品名稱與其所對應藥量的確認資訊給該控制模組,以致該控制模組控制該藥品名稱對應的名稱燈號與數量燈號不顯示該第一顏色的號誌。The step (c) is that the mobile device transmits, to each drug name, a pair of confirmation information indicating the name of the drug and the corresponding drug amount to the control module, so that the control module controls the name lamp corresponding to the drug name and The number of lights does not display the number of the first color.
該步驟(d)是當該控制模組判斷出該藥方資訊中的至少一藥品名稱對應的名稱燈號與數量燈號均不顯示該第一顏色的號誌時,該控制模組控制該至少一藥品名稱對應的藥罐輸出該藥品名稱對應的藥量。The step (d) is: when the control module determines that the name light number and the quantity light number corresponding to the at least one drug name in the prescription information do not display the number of the first color, the control module controls the at least A medicine tank corresponding to a medicine name outputs a medicine amount corresponding to the medicine name.

參閱圖1,本發明的包藥方法由一電腦1、一行動裝置2與一包藥系統3實施。該包藥系統3包含多個藥品模組31、一控制模組32、多個裁切與研磨模組33,及一集藥模組34。Referring to Figure 1, the method of dispensing a drug of the present invention is carried out by a computer 1, a mobile device 2 and a drug dispensing system 3. The drug dispensing system 3 includes a plurality of drug modules 31, a control module 32, a plurality of cutting and polishing modules 33, and a drug collecting module 34.
該行動裝置2例如是平板電腦或智慧手機,並由藥劑師所持用。該電腦1適於設置在診間,用於提供醫師輸入病歷與開立藥方。The mobile device 2 is, for example, a tablet or a smart phone and is used by a pharmacist. The computer 1 is adapted to be placed in a clinic for providing a physician to enter a medical record and to open a prescription.
每一藥品模組31對應一藥品名稱且包括一藥罐311、一名稱燈號312、一數量燈號313,及一型態燈號314。較佳地,每一燈號為一LED燈號,且可受控於該控制模組32而顯示紅色的文字或綠色的文字;且初始地,每一燈號不亮燈。Each medicine module 31 corresponds to a medicine name and includes a medicine tank 311, a name light number 312, a quantity number 313, and a type lamp number 314. Preferably, each light is an LED light, and can be controlled by the control module 32 to display red text or green text; and initially, each light does not light.
該控制模組32電連接該等藥品模組31並可與該電腦1與該行動裝置2無線通訊;較佳地,該控制模組32具有一無線通訊單元(圖未示),並透過該無線通訊單元,利用WiFi或藍牙等短距無線通訊協定來跟該電腦1與該行動裝置2通訊。The control module 32 is electrically connected to the medical module 31 and can communicate with the mobile device 2 and the mobile device 2; preferably, the control module 32 has a wireless communication unit (not shown) The wireless communication unit communicates with the mobile device 2 with the short-range wireless communication protocol such as WiFi or Bluetooth.
該等裁切與研磨模組33分別經由輸送管35連接該等藥罐311,且經由輸送管35連接該集藥模組34。較佳地,該集藥模組34為一現有的包藥機。The cutting and polishing modules 33 are connected to the medicine tanks 311 via the transport tubes 35, and the medicine collecting modules 34 are connected via the transport tubes 35. Preferably, the medicinal module 34 is an existing drug hopper.
參閱圖2~4,以下說明本發明包藥方法的步驟。Referring to Figures 2 to 4, the steps of the method of administering the present invention are described below.
首先,在步驟S1,醫師在看診完畢之後在該電腦1中輸入要開立的藥方資訊,其中該藥方資訊包含多個藥品名稱及該等藥品名稱各別對應的藥量與藥品型態。First, in step S1, the physician inputs the prescription information to be opened in the computer 1 after the medical examination is completed, wherein the prescription information includes a plurality of drug names and a drug amount and a drug type corresponding to the drug names.
接著,在步驟S2,該電腦1將該藥方資訊傳送給藥劑師所持用的行動裝置2與該包藥系統3的控制模組32。Next, in step S2, the computer 1 transmits the prescription information to the mobile device 2 held by the pharmacist and the control module 32 of the drug dispensing system 3.
接著,在步驟S3,如圖3所示,該行動裝置2在接收到該藥方資訊後在其螢幕21上顯示該藥方資訊中的每一藥品名稱及其對應的藥量與藥品型態,且對應每一藥品名稱顯示一確認按鈕211。該控制模組32在接收到該藥方資訊後,控制該藥方資訊中的每一藥品名稱所對應的藥品模組31的名稱燈號312、數量燈號313與型態燈號314顯示紅色的號誌。舉例來說,參閱圖3與圖4,該藥方資訊如下列表一,藥品模組31a與藥品模組31b已經預先設定好分別對應「普拿疼」與「賜胃福」兩種藥品,該控制模組32在接收到該藥方資訊後,控制藥品模組31a的名稱燈號312a顯示紅色的「普拿疼」字串、數量燈號313a顯示紅色的「一顆」字串、型態燈號314a顯示紅色的「粉末」字串;並控制控制藥品模組31b的名稱燈號312b顯示紅色的「賜胃福」字串、數量燈號313b顯示紅色的「半顆」字串、型態燈號314b顯示紅色的「顆粒」字串。此外,不是對應「普拿疼」或「賜胃福」的其他藥品模組31的該等燈號不亮燈。 表一:藥方資訊 <TABLE border="1" borderColor="#000000" width="85%"><TBODY><tr><td><b>藥品名稱</b></td><td><b>藥量</b></td><td><b>藥品型態</b></td></tr><tr><td> 普拿疼 </td><td> 一顆 </td><td> 粉末 </td></tr><tr><td> 賜胃福 </td><td> 半顆 </td><td> 顆粒 </td></tr></TBODY></TABLE>Next, in step S3, as shown in FIG. 3, after receiving the prescription information, the mobile device 2 displays, on its screen 21, each drug name in the prescription information and its corresponding drug amount and drug type, and A confirmation button 211 is displayed for each drug name. After receiving the prescription information, the control module 32 controls the name of the medicine module 31 corresponding to each medicine name in the prescription information, the name light number 312, the quantity light number 313 and the type light number 314 display a red number. 接著,在步驟S4,藥劑師逐一核對紅色號誌所顯示的每一藥品名稱及其對應的藥量與藥品型態,若確認一藥品名稱及其對應的藥量與藥品型態的資訊正確,則在該行動裝置2的螢幕21上點選該藥品名稱對應的確認按鈕211,以致該行動裝置2傳送一對應該藥品名稱的確認訊息給該控制模組32;且該控制模組32在接收到該確認訊息之後,控制該藥品名稱對應的名稱燈號312、數量燈號313與型態燈號314轉為綠色的號誌。舉例來說,參閱圖3與圖4,藥劑師先確認了「普拿疼」與其藥量與藥品型態的資訊正確,故藥品模組31a的該等燈號312a、313a、314a由紅色轉為綠色;接著藥劑師再確認了「賜胃福」與其藥量與藥品型態的資訊正確,故接著藥品模組31b的該等燈號312b、313b、314b由紅色轉為綠色。此外,如圖3所示,該行動裝置2還在其螢幕21上顯示一重新設定按鈕212,若藥劑師發現該藥方資訊有誤,可點選該重新設定按鈕212,以致該行動裝置2傳送一通知訊息給該電腦1,以提醒診間的醫師再次確認藥方資訊的正確性並重新開立藥方;同時,該行動裝置2也會傳送一通知訊息給該包藥系統3的該控制模組32,以致該控制模組32控制每一已亮燈的燈號恢復到不亮燈的初始狀態。Next, in step S4, the pharmacist checks each drug name and its corresponding drug amount and drug type displayed by the red number one by one. If it is confirmed that the information of a drug name and its corresponding drug amount and drug type is correct, Then, the confirmation button 211 corresponding to the drug name is clicked on the screen 21 of the mobile device 2, so that the mobile device 2 transmits a confirmation message indicating the name of the drug to the control module 32; and the control module 32 is receiving After the confirmation message, the name light number 312, the quantity light number 313 and the type light number 314 corresponding to the medicine name are controlled to be green. For example, referring to Fig. 3 and Fig. 4, the pharmacist first confirms that the information of "Pu Na pain" and its drug amount and drug type is correct, so the lamp numbers 312a, 313a, 314a of the drug module 31a are changed from red to red. It was green; then the pharmacist reconfirmed that the information of "Zhiweifu" and its drug amount and drug type was correct, so that the lamp numbers 312b, 313b, and 314b of the drug module 31b were changed from red to green. In addition, as shown in FIG. 3, the mobile device 2 also displays a reset button 212 on its screen 21. If the pharmacist finds that the prescription information is incorrect, the reset button 212 can be clicked, so that the mobile device 2 transmits A notification message is sent to the computer 1 to remind the physician at the clinic to reconfirm the correctness of the prescription information and reopen the prescription; at the same time, the mobile device 2 also transmits a notification message to the control module of the dispensing system 3 32, so that the control module 32 controls the light of each of the lights to return to the initial state of not lighting.
接著,在步驟S5,該控制模組32判斷是否該藥方資訊中的每一藥品名稱對應的該等燈號均顯示綠色號誌,且當判斷結果為肯定時執行步驟S6。Next, in step S5, the control module 32 determines whether the light numbers corresponding to each drug name in the prescription information display a green number, and when the determination result is affirmative, step S6 is performed.
接著,在步驟S6,該控制模組32控制該藥方資訊中的每一藥品名稱對應的藥品模組31的藥罐311,透過該輸送管35輸出該藥品名稱對應的藥量給該藥罐311所連接的裁切與研磨模組33,進而該控制模組32控制該裁切與研磨模組33根據該藥品名稱對應的藥品型態產生呈顆粒或粉末狀的藥品,並透過該輸送管35將該藥品輸出給該集藥模組34,以進一步分裝該等藥品。Next, in step S6, the control module 32 controls the medicine tank 311 of the medicine module 31 corresponding to each medicine name in the prescription information, and outputs the medicine amount corresponding to the medicine name to the medicine tank 311 through the delivery tube 35. The cutting and polishing module 33 is connected, and the control module 32 controls the cutting and polishing module 33 to generate a drug in the form of particles or powder according to the drug type corresponding to the drug name, and passes through the delivery tube 35. The drug is output to the drug collection module 34 to further dispense the drugs.
特別地,上述的包藥方法能使藥劑師不再需要熟記每一藥品的放置位置,也能讓藥劑師更方便地確認藥品及其對應藥量與藥品型態的正確性,減輕藥劑師的精神負擔,進而減少/避免調劑錯誤。In particular, the above-mentioned method of dispensing allows the pharmacist to no longer need to memorize the placement of each drug, and also allows the pharmacist to more easily confirm the correctness of the drug and its corresponding drug amount and drug type, and to reduce the pharmacist. The mental burden, which in turn reduces/avoids adjustment errors.
